/**
|
|
* `useDeployment` — view-model for `Settings → Deployment` (ticket #68).
|
|
*
|
|
* Owns the draft exposure config, the backend-derived preview, and the embedded
|
|
* server lifecycle. All behaviour lives here so `DeploymentSettings` stays
|
|
* presentation-only (no `invoke()`, no network reasoning in JSX).
|
|
*
|
|
* **The backend owns every network fact.** LAN candidates and the proxy upstream
|
|
* URL are read from `previewExposure`; nothing here derives an address.
|
|
*
|
|
* Two backend behaviours shape this hook:
|
|
*
|
|
* 1. `preview_server_exposure_settings` *validates* before previewing, so an
|
|
* incomplete draft is rejected rather than previewed. That makes it the
|
|
* UI's validation authority (it returns the same message `start` would), but
|
|
* it also means a `remoteProxyOtherMachine` draft cannot be previewed until
|
|
* it already carries a LAN bind address — which is what the preview is for.
|
|
* So the LAN candidate list is fetched with a separate always-valid
|
|
* `localOnly` probe; the backend builds that list independently of the mode.
|
|
* 2. Only `start` reports a runtime failure, so a rejected save/start surfaces
|
|
* the backend message verbatim — it is the concrete correction to apply.
|
|
*/
